Transaction 87cb90fa80891d16a3e8aaa011ba39873ffacc43d4444f14410c1be89a0c5554
1 Input
1 Output
-
87cb90fa80891d16a3e8aaa011ba39873ffacc43d4444f14410c1be89a0c5554:0
- value
- 1062664
- script pubkey
- OP_0 OP_PUSHBYTES_20 2bd6529d96e819ac84065dbe002a7d631f09554d
- address
- bc1q90t998vkaqv6epqxtklqq2navv0sj42dc0mlsf